Welcome to Sugarbusters! This is the Sugarbusters support board, where anyone following, or interested in following, Sugarbusters is welcome to come for discussion, and support. We hope you will become a part of our great group!

We try to have different themes for different days of the week.


MONDAY: MMM, or Metal Monster Monday, is when we weigh in, and post our progress. This is voluntary.

TUESDAY: Is tip day- we try to share a tip, or two to help each other.

WEDNESDAY: Is Wonderful Wednesday. On Wednesdays, we share something wonderful about our selves, or our lives.

THURSDAY: Is Thirst Day! A reminder to drink your water! Its a good day to share a recipe too!

FRIDAY: Is FF, for Friday funnies. Everyone needs a laugh on Friday!


You are welcome to post questions, vent frustrations, whatever, but please be respectful of others and their beliefs.

TONI: I made your cauliflower salad last night. I forgot to add the splenda, but it is really good without it. Thank you for posting it! It was so easy, since I used the packaged crumbled cooked bacon you can buy at Costco. I even put the crumbles in the microwave to 'crisp' them up and it worked pretty well. I used mayo instead of miracle whip, cause that is what I had, and added a little dried onion. Oh, gosh it is good this morning! I love having salads like that in the fridge!
